Great Special $20 dollars for 18 with a cart-- price can_t be beat (unless you factor price of lost balls- most shanked shots result in a lost ball.) This goat ranch navigates through really steep terrain, with narrow fairways lined with 60_ trees. A fair amount of danger on every approach. Fun and frustrating for beginners, seasoned golfers will definitely not enjoy it, the reason why you see mostly newbies and hacks. Place is usually never crowded... you can usually golf at your own pace as quick or slow as your heart desires. Poor design on several of the holes. Hole nine is a joke, 60 yards over a line of 50 ft trees, ive yet to see someone play over the trees successfully. My tip for getting on the green is 5 iron low off the cartpath one hop to the front edge of the hill trickled down to the green. Generally the greens are inconsistent from hole to hole, either extremely fast or slow makes getting any rhythm with putts difficult. The back nine are extremely frustrating. Lots of water in all the wrong spots it seems. Summary: Inexpensive cheap thrill for beginners. |

Rolling Knolls Country Club Addtional Information & History
Rolling Knolls Country Club: The Rolling Knolls golf course at the Rolling Knolls Country Club in Elgin, Illinois is an 18-hole executive course with narrow, tree-lined fairways. Eleven of the holes feature water in play. Rolling Knolls offers 3,916 yards of golf from the longest tees for a par of 66. The course rating is 60.2 and it has a slope rating of 114. Designed by Russell Schneider, the Rolling Knolls golf course opened in 1962.
